About L. Ramello

L. Ramello is a scholar working on Nuclear and High Energy Physics, Radiation, Radiology, Nuclear Medicine and Imaging, Biomedical Engineering and Pulmonary and Respiratory Medicine, having authored 44 papers that have together received 286 indexed citations. Recurring topics across this work include Particle Detector Development and Performance (24 papers), High-Energy Particle Collisions Research (14 papers), Medical Imaging Techniques and Applications (12 papers), Advanced X-ray and CT Imaging (11 papers), Radiation Detection and Scintillator Technologies (11 papers), Particle physics theoretical and experimental studies (11 papers), Nuclear Physics and Applications (6 papers) and Digital Radiography and Breast Imaging (5 papers). The work is most often cited by research in Radiation (143 citations), Nuclear and High Energy Physics (185 citations), Radiology, Nuclear Medicine and Imaging (62 citations), Biomedical Engineering (81 citations) and Electrical and Electronic Engineering (100 citations). L. Ramello has collaborated with scholars based in Italy, Poland and Switzerland. Frequent co-authors include P. Giubellino, P. Gryboś, K. Świentek, F. Prino, R. Wheadon, S. Roe, G. Hall, K. Gill, M. Idzik and M. Gambaccini. Their work appears in journals such as Nuclear Instruments and Methods in Physics Research Section A Accelerators Spectrometers Detectors and Associated Equipment, IEEE Transactions on Nuclear Science, Physics Letters B, Medical Physics and Physical Chemistry Chemical Physics.
